Do you stake your pepper plants? This year I'll be planting habanero,
jalapeno, serrano, cayenne, pablano, garden salsa, banana, and bell peppers.


I usually put those little cheap sorry tomato cages around my peppers. It
helps prevent broken branches when there's a wind storm or if they have a
heavy fruit load.

I fence the entire garden with 3' high chickenwire. They
could jump that - they're large-ish dogs - but they never
do. The chickenwire fence keeps rabbits out too.
